IDN

A lightweight, yet fast Internet browser that features a well-organized interface, enabling you to quic...
Download

IDN Ranking & Summary

Advertisement

  • Rating:
  • License:
  • Freeware
  • Publisher Name:
  • IDN Software
  • Operating Systems:
  • Windows XP / Vista / 7 / 8 / 8 64 bit
  • File Size:
  • 312 KB

IDN Tags


IDN Description

IDN provides users with a simplistic web browser that is focused on speed, rather than complicated configuration options. Therefore, the interface is intuitive (only basic navigation buttons are included, along with the address bar) and users can open multiple browser instances.


IDN Related Software